      Main duties of the job

      The EPR PAS Team Leader will be responsible for the day to day running of the EPR PAS Team. They provide back office support for Wye Valley Trust Electronic Patient Record system namely Maxims.

      The Trust's EPR PAS Team Leader has the responsibility of ensuring that the quality of data within the EPR System is of a high level of accuracy as the system data quality affects national, strategic and internal reporting. The role liaises directly with system suppliers internal and external e.g. MAXIMS and system managers and WVT Information Dept system managers to ensure all data is accurate and follows the National Data Dictionary definitions. This role ensures that data capture accurately reflects the activity that has been recorded, maximising the Trust's income and ensuring no loss of revenue. This role also provides support to the Digital Dictation Manager.

      National Health Service (NHS) is the umbrella term for the publicly-funded healthcare systems of the United Kingdom (UK). The founding principles were that services should be comprehensive, universal and free at the point of delivery—a health service based on clinical need, not ability to pay. Each service provides a comprehensive range of health services, free at the point of use for people ordinarily resident in the United Kingdom apart from dental treatment and optical care.
